Another breast case.....

Biopsy showed 8:00 breast with mucinous type infil ductal ca. 9:00
breast with infil ductal and infil lobular ca with DCIS.

Surgery showed infiltrating mixed ductal and lobular carcinoma, grade
2, 3.5 cm with extensive DCIS and LCIS. 0/24 nodes and negative
margins.

What is the histology? Is this two primaries?
